Ananda’s décor redefines customer’s expectations of Indian restaurants. The dining room features a number of striking design statements, which are quietly opulent while complementing the comfortable welcoming warmth of the design theme. The eye is drawn up to the glowingly rich, honey-coloured, water lily inspired chandeliers, while aubergine, lime and cerise velvet upholstery adds vibrancy and life to the seating. Throughout, snug spaces are created by the clever use of black textured string veils. Throughout, modern Indian paintings and motifs mix with textured European finishes, bringing east and west together to sing in harmony.
